Opened in 1898 by the London & North Western Railway on the line from Crewe to Chester, this station replaced an 1840 one some 800m behind the camera position (see Image). In turn, this station closed to passengers in 1959 and completely in 1965. View north west towards Chester. The southbound platform building and goods shed were still extant when this image was taken. For more information, see http://www.disused-stations.org.uk/w/waverton/index1.shtml.
